    Donna Luther is with Xavier House. She says the Presentation sisters started Xavier House in the eighties and without Xavier House, these residents would have nowhere to go.

    Homelessness is an invisible issue in Corner Brook. We don’t have a tent city like the capital but there are couch surfers and people without a safe place to go. Luther says there is homelessness in Corner Brook and across the whole province. The Xavier House Toonie Quest West is a fundraiser to help the residents.
